From 419de5c001387e052fe3a301a2c1aa642af27119 Mon Sep 17 00:00:00 2001 From: Hauke Mehrtens Date: Wed, 22 Dec 2010 01:56:37 +0000 Subject: [PATCH] libiconv: add external var _libiconv_version This is needed by php5 and also provieded by the libiconv-full SVN-Revision: 24775 --- libs/libiconv/Makefile | 2 +- libs/libiconv/src/iconv.c | 3 ++- libs/libiconv/src/include/iconv.h | 3 +++ 3 files changed, 6 insertions(+), 2 deletions(-) diff --git a/libs/libiconv/Makefile b/libs/libiconv/Makefile index ccce71d039..d51b47fbac 100644 --- a/libs/libiconv/Makefile +++ b/libs/libiconv/Makefile @@ -27,7 +27,7 @@ define Build/Configure endef define Build/Compile - $(TARGET_CC) -c $(PKG_BUILD_DIR)/iconv.c -o $(PKG_BUILD_DIR)/iconv.o + $(TARGET_CC) -c $(PKG_BUILD_DIR)/iconv.c -o $(PKG_BUILD_DIR)/iconv.o -I$(PKG_BUILD_DIR)/include $(TARGET_CROSS)ar rcs $(PKG_BUILD_DIR)/libiconv.a $(PKG_BUILD_DIR)/iconv.o endef diff --git a/libs/libiconv/src/iconv.c b/libs/libiconv/src/iconv.c index 5834f6173d..e85b99a229 100644 --- a/libs/libiconv/src/iconv.c +++ b/libs/libiconv/src/iconv.c @@ -3,8 +3,9 @@ */ #include +#include -typedef void *iconv_t; +int _libiconv_version = _LIBICONV_VERSION; iconv_t iconv_open (const char *tocode, const char *fromcode) { diff --git a/libs/libiconv/src/include/iconv.h b/libs/libiconv/src/include/iconv.h index bca749a66d..29c2d2a6f6 100644 --- a/libs/libiconv/src/include/iconv.h +++ b/libs/libiconv/src/include/iconv.h @@ -5,6 +5,9 @@ #ifndef _ICONV_H #define _ICONV_H 1 +#define _LIBICONV_VERSION 0x010B /* version number: (major<<8) + minor */ +extern int _libiconv_version; /* Likewise */ + #include typedef void *iconv_t; -- 2.30.2